Step-by-step explanation:

The given terms are:

  • Proof
  • Axiom
  • Theorem:

Proof:  A logical argument showing that a theorem is true. It is used to show the truth of a mathematical statement

Axiom: A given definition assumed  to be true. The term axiom is used in two related but distinguishable senses: "logical axioms" and "non-logical axioms".

Theorem:  A statement that requires  proof. A theorem is a statement that can be demonstrated to be true by accepted mathematical operations and arguments...
